There are indications that Arsenal might replace third choice goalkeeper David Ospina who is reported to be preparing for a move away from the club in the coming winter transfer window. David Ospina was a second choice goalkeeper to Petr Cech as at last season under former manager Arsene Wenger but that changed with the coming of a new manager and the signing of Bernd Leno from German Bundesliga outfit Bayer Leverkusen.
